Greek History Comp is No Tragedy for Aoife!

Congratulations to Aoife from P7B who won a recent writing competition, organised by the Classical Association of Northern Ireland (CANI).

In early March, the P7s took part in a Greek history workshop at The Ulster Museum, orgainised by CANI. Following on from this, the pupils were invited to enter a competition, writing about an aspect of their experience at the workshop.

Aoife chose to create this wonderful poem, which impressed the judges and earned her a £20 book token!

IMG_8864 (1).JPG

Amber Taylor, Chair of CANI, commented on Aoife's work...

On behalf of CANI, I want to congratulate Aoife on securing first place in our School’s Conference competition! We are so impressed that someone of your age has been able to write such a well structured, eloquent poem (I especially love the very last line!). In coming first place, you have won the £20 book token and a certificate from CANI!

Having won the competition, Aoife has also been asked by CANI to record a recital of her poem for their 'Short Series' YouTube channel.

Well done Aoife!
